OAKLAND, Calif. -- Zhone Technologies, Inc. (ZHNE), a global leader in the fiber access market, today reported its financial results for the fourth quarter ended December 31, 2014.

Revenue for the fourth quarter of 2014 was $30.1 million compared to $29.4 million for the third quarter of 2014 and $32.3 million for the fourth quarter of 2013. Net loss for the fourth quarter of 2014, calculated in accordance with generally accepted accounting principles (“GAAP”), was $2.1 million or $0.06 per share compared with net loss of $2.7 million or $0.08 per share for the third quarter of 2014 and net income of $1.4 million or $0.04 per share for the fourth quarter of 2013. Adjusted earnings before stock-based compensation, interest, taxes, and depreciation (“adjusted EBITDA”) was an adjusted EBITDA loss of $1.7 million for the fourth quarter of 2014, compared to an adjusted EBITDA loss of $2.2 million for the third quarter of 2014 and an adjusted EBITDA profit of $1.6 million for the fourth quarter of 2013.

"We entered 2015 with a renewed level of confidence that we will grow revenue in both our service provider and enterprise businesses," stated Jim Norrod, Zhone's chief executive officer. "We are equally confident that our focused business structure and decisive business restructuring will lead to profitability which remains our primary financial objective."

Cash and cash equivalents at December 31, 2014 was $11.5 million compared to $15.7 million at December 31, 2013.
